Constitutional Law I #13: Commerce Clause Wrap-Up Monday, Sep 26 2005
1L and Constitutional Law and Constitutional Law I and Neil Wehneman 7:29 pm
In this episode we will finish substantively discussing Commerce Clause questions. We will take and apply the framework from Lopez to Morrison and Raich. I will conclude by giving my personal belief in how we should interpret the Commerce Clause so as to not allow one clause to overshadow Constitutional structures.
